5 Tips for Buying Vitamins Online

Buying vitamin supplements online is convenient, and you can save money if you shop wisely. Follow these tips to make sure you get good deals and quality products.

  1. Save money by comparing prices.

    After you have found the vitamin supplement you want made by the brand you want, do a keyword search on that product. Your search should yield many results, allowing you to compare prices at a glance.

  2. Look for discount codes and shipping rates.

    Many coupon sites list current discount codes for retail websites. These codes can be entered into special areas when you check out. When looking for the best deal, do not forget to add in shipping costs, however, as this can substantially increase the final cost for your vitamin supplement. What may initially appear to be a great price on a product may not be a good deal after all if shipping is expensive.

  3. Look at label information.

    Most websites offer a description of the vitamin product and a list of the ingredients. You may also be able to view a large, readable image of the label itself. Check the ingredients to make sure you are getting the vitamin you desire without ingredients you do not need or want. For example, some products listed as green tea extract for weight loss, may contain additional ingredients that may not be appropriate for you.

  4. Look at the guarantees offered on the website.

    Does the company offer a refund or an exchange if you are not satisfied? Do they have a quality guarantee? Is the company in good standing with the Better Business Bureau (BBB)? The latter can be checked by visiting the BBB website or by looking for the BBB seal. Refunds are not always allowed for products such as vitamins after they are opened, but you should at least be allowed to exchange the product. Additionally, many supplements lose healthy benefits after the “use by” date.

  5. Stick with brands you know.

    This does not mean all of your vitamins must be name brand. However, it is wise to stick with well-known companies that have more at stake and are most likely to follow strict guidelines regarding the use of fillers and the prevention of contamination of the product.

Vitamin supplements can be a healthy addition to your daily routine, but choosing them smartly helps you get a better, safer deal. Taking those extra steps to research the supplements, prices, and websites offering the vitamin supplements is important.
